Brighton Announce Appointment Of De Zerbi As New Manager

September 18, (THEWILL) – Roberto De Zerbi has been named as Brighton and Hove Albion’s next head coach.

The Italian, signed a four-year contract at the American Express Community Stadium on Sunday, and he has been appointed as Graham Potter’s replacement.

After a strong start to the season under Potter, who left for Chelsea on September 8, and 13 points from their first six games, De Zerbi takes over with Brighton as high as fourth in the English Premier League.

Due to the conflict in Ukraine, the 43-year-old had been out of work since leaving Shakhtar Donetsk in July. But, on October 1, he will take over as manager of Brighton and call the shots on their away match against Liverpool.

De Zerbi, who has coached Palermo, Benevento, and Sassuolo in the Italian top division, will bring some of Serie A experience to the Brighton dugout. During his three years with Sassuolo, the former Milan and Napoli attacking midfielder was notable for leading the club to back-to-back eighth-place finishes.
